## PR: Stricter enclosure checks in FeedLint

This change tightens how FeedLint validates podcast enclosures for the Castwhistle ingest pipeline. We now reject feeds with missing byte lengths, malformed GUIDs, or episode art below the minimum resolution, instead of logging a warning and moving on. Retry behavior on flaky remote feeds is unchanged, but timeouts are now configurable per host. If you're new to this repo, start with the validator module before touching the fetcher. The constants below control validation thresholds and retry pacing.

tuning table, yajog-yahof:
BUDGETS = {
    "lamvan": 303,
    "wenox": 460,
    "fenvan": 525,
}

Handing off the Quillbend consent banner rollout. It's at 40% of traffic, region-gated. Known issue: the dismiss event double-fires on the Varro storefront; fix is in review. If complaint volume spikes, drop the rollout percentage rather than disabling outright — full disable breaks the preference centre. Rollback takes effect within five minutes. Current production settings for the banner service are listed below.

settings of fafog-haduf:
ZORIX_PIN=4648
ZORIX_METRICS_HOST=metrics.zorix.paliqsys.corp
ZORIX_LOG_LEVEL=info
ZORIX_TENANT=druix

CI note for release manager: parity check between the Swiftel iOS SDK and the Kestrel Android SDK is red. Android is missing the offline queue flush API added in iOS last sprint. Parity gate will block the cut until the Android branch merges. Do not tag the release candidate yet. The last fully green parity run is the token below.

pipeline stamp: htk9_ce63042d9

Subject: Key rotation for InvoiceForge renderer

Welcome, new folks. Every quarter we rotate the credential the Pellworth PDF invoice renderer uses to call our internal asset service, Vaultline. The old key stops working Friday at noon. Update your local .env and the staging config before then, and verify a test invoice renders with the new embedded fonts. For convenience, the freshly issued key is included here.

app token of bagef-bageg = kto11_vuwA0uhrEMg